Performs laboratory tests of moderate and high complexity and prepares records of test results. Maintains instruments, equipment, and supplies.
Essential Functions:
- Prepares and calibrates test instruments and equipment to assure accuracy of tests.
- Prepares specimens and performs laboratory tests of moderate and high complexity as defined in laboratory procedures manual.
- Discusses unexpected or unreasonable test results to supervisor.
- Reports the results of each test and related test data by entering information in computer database.
- Prepares, distributes, and files forms and reports.
- Cleans instruments and equipment as needed following each test.
- Performs maintenance and minor repairs to instruments and equipment.
- Recognizes equipment malfunctions and notifies appropriate personnel.
- Assists newly assigned staff to learn laboratory procedures.
- Performs other related duties as directed.
